Discover your dream homestead ranch nestled within the serene landscapes of Orangefield ISD. This meticulously updated 3-bed, 2-bath home sits on a spacious 9.386-acre estate, offering comfort and functionality for your family. Step onto the property and find a 72 x 30 workshop with built-in cabinets, a workspace, and a full-size refrigerator. Multiple carports provide shelter for vehicles, boats, and farm equipment. An insulated 12x24 bunkhouse and an 80x40 RV shed are ready for guests and recreational vehicles. Animal lovers will appreciate barns in the back and side pastures, ponds stocked with different fish species, a 60x40 house pad, and a covered patio with an outdoor kitchen area. Security features include a state-of-the-art system with night vision. Fully fenced with coded gate entry, this property combines luxury, functionality, and natural beauty for the ultimate ranch lifestyle experience.
